大力兄:再问你关于sp_textcopy(image属性)的问题。
CREATE PROCEDURE sp_textcopy (
@srvname varchar (30),
@login varchar (30),
@password varchar (30),
@dbname varchar (30),
@tbname varchar (30),
@colname varchar (120),
@filename varchar (120),
@whereclause varchar (40),
@direction char(1))
AS
DECLARE @exec_str varchar (425)
SELECT @exec_str =
'textcopy /S ' + @srvname +
' /U ' + @login +
' /P ' + @password +
' /D ' + @dbname +
' /T ' + @tbname +
' /C ' + @colname +
' /W "' + @whereclause +
'" /F ' + @filename +
' /' + @direction
EXEC master..xp_cmdshell @exec_str
我运行时出现
ERROR: Text or image pointer and timestamp retrieval failed.
并且以后老是阴魂不散,任何调试都会出现这种错误。我唯一的解决办法是重装sqlsever。怎么办?请赐教。
问题点数:0、回复次数:4Top
1 楼letsflytogether(伍子)回复于 2003-09-09 09:57:28 得分 0
我遇到的问题是
'textcopy' 不是内部或外部命令,也不是可运行的程序或批处理文件。
如何解决
Top
2 楼pengdali()回复于 2003-09-09 10:07:49 得分 0
楼主是不是先insert了一个0x呢?
楼上
如果报textcopy不是可执行文件的话,你就到
C:\Program Files\Microsoft SQL Server\MSSQL\Binn
目录下拷备 textcopy.exe到:
C:\Program Files\Microsoft SQL Server\80\Tools\BinnTop
3 楼LovenDreams(爱拼才会赢)回复于 2003-11-12 11:51:49 得分 0
pengdali(大力 V3.0) :
你这种方法是可以,但你会不会觉得很慢呢?
读出一张图片文件都比较慢,如果我有几千条数据,就要调用几千次该存储过程了,感觉很慢很慢!Top
4 楼pengdali()回复于 2003-11-12 11:54:59 得分 0
是的。那你用程序做。Top




